Hope you like the following recipe using Jiffy corn muffin mix as well.

I usually make everything from scratch, but this is one I find is better than if I made it from scratch.
I make up one box of JIFFY corn muffins, but add 1 full cup, more or less to you taste, of blueberries, fresh or frozen. Makes 4-5 Texas sized muffins. If using frozen berries do NOT thaw.
May not sound like much but if you dip the tops of the hot muffins in a mix of fresh lemon juice and melted butter, then in sugar.....MMMMMMMMM!!!
You could use those decorator sugars to dress them up, and fancy cupcake papers.
The extras, if there are any (LOL), freeze well.
